SUMMARY:

Under the direction of our Maintenance Manager, the Maintenance Technician is responsible for the care and maintenance of all property and production assets in a safe, sanitary and efficient condition. The Maintenance Technician is responsible for staying up to date on new products, equipment, technology and techniques. This facility produces a variety of dairy products as safely and efficiently as possible, while meeting all corporate, customer, and government requirements.

D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

Ensure operation of machinery and mechanical equipment by completing maintenance requirements (both planned and unplanned) on production, packaging, processing equipment and utility systems (to provide a continuous supply of heat, steam, cooling, electrical, power, gas or air required for operations)

Readily available for emergency repairs I breakdown situations

Read, analyze and interpret technical procedure, electrical schematics, service manuals and work orders to perform required maintenance and service

Perform preventative maintenance (i.e. conducting computerized preventative maintenance check-ups or reading SPC charts and data)

Line manufacturing support systems (ozone , line/lube delivery, chemical delivery, ingredient delivery)

Complete work orders in a timely manner, maintaining high quality standards

Use a variety of hand and power tools, electric meters and material handling equipment in performing duties

Maintain communication with other departments, management and employees and notify them of any problems and/or concerns that may restrict the efficiency of production

Ensure all paperwork is filled out in a clear, legible and accurate format, and completed with the required information. Ensure all required information is documented in accordance with SOPs

Assist in maintaining parts and supplies inventory by reporting low supply levels to Supervisor

Maintain a clean, sanitary and safe work area

Follow all required work safe practices, including but not limited to: Lockout-tag out requirements and wearing of all required PPE in designated areas, confined space safety, safe chemical handling and fall restraints.

Responsible for food safety, pre-requisite programs and food quality related to designated area. Report any food safety and food quality related issues to management immediately

Performs other related duties as assigned by management.
